PolicySetDefinitionVersionsOperations interface
Interfaccia che rappresenta operazioni PolicySetDefinitionVersions.
Proprietà
| create |
Questa operazione crea o aggiorna una versione di definizione del set di policy nell'abbonamento fornito con il nome e la versione di battesimo. |
| create |
Questa operazione crea o aggiorna una versione di definizione del set di policy nel gruppo di gestione specifico con il nome e la versione. |
| delete | |
| delete |
Questa operazione elimina la versione della definizione del set di policy nel gruppo di gestione dato con il nome e la versione di battesimo. |
| get | Questa operazione recupera la versione della definizione del set di policy nell'abbonamento fornito con il nome e la versione. |
| get |
Questa operazione recupera la versione della definizione del set di policy nel gruppo di gestione dato con il nome e la versione propria. |
| get |
Questa operazione recupera la versione integrata della definizione del set di policy con il nome e la versione. |
| list | Questa operazione recupera una lista di tutte le versioni di definizione del set di policy per la definizione del set di policy data. |
| list |
Questa operazione elenca tutte le versioni di definizione di set di policy per tutte le definizioni di set di policy all'interno di un abbonamento. |
| list |
Questa operazione elenca tutte le versioni di definizione dei set di policy per tutte le definizioni di set di policy nell'ambito del gruppo di gestione. |
| list |
Questa operazione elenca tutte le versioni integrate delle definizioni di set di policy per tutte le definizioni di set di policy integrate. |
| list |
Questa operazione recupera un elenco di tutte le versioni di definizione del set di policy integrate per la definizione del set di policy integrata data. |
| list |
Questa operazione recupera un elenco di tutte le versioni di definizione del set di policy per la definizione del set di policy data in un dato gruppo di gestione. |
Dettagli proprietà
createOrUpdate
Questa operazione crea o aggiorna una versione di definizione del set di policy nell'abbonamento fornito con il nome e la versione di battesimo.
createOrUpdate: (policySetDefinitionName: string, policyDefinitionVersion: string, parameters: PolicySetDefinitionVersion, options?: PolicySetDefinitionVersionsCreateOrUpdateOptionalParams) => Promise<PolicySetDefinitionVersion>
Valore della proprietà
(policySetDefinitionName: string, policyDefinitionVersion: string, parameters: PolicySetDefinitionVersion, options?: PolicySetDefinitionVersionsCreateOrUpdateOptionalParams) => Promise<PolicySetDefinitionVersion>
createOrUpdateAtManagementGroup
Questa operazione crea o aggiorna una versione di definizione del set di policy nel gruppo di gestione specifico con il nome e la versione.
createOrUpdateAtManagementGroup: (managementGroupName: string, policySetDefinitionName: string, policyDefinitionVersion: string, parameters: PolicySetDefinitionVersion, options?: PolicySetDefinitionVersionsCreateOrUpdateAtManagementGroupOptionalParams) => Promise<PolicySetDefinitionVersion>
Valore della proprietà
(managementGroupName: string, policySetDefinitionName: string, policyDefinitionVersion: string, parameters: PolicySetDefinitionVersion, options?: PolicySetDefinitionVersionsCreateOrUpdateAtManagementGroupOptionalParams) => Promise<PolicySetDefinitionVersion>
delete
delete: (policySetDefinitionName: string, policyDefinitionVersion: string, options?: PolicySetDefinitionVersionsDeleteOptionalParams) => Promise<void>
Valore della proprietà
(policySetDefinitionName: string, policyDefinitionVersion: string, options?: PolicySetDefinitionVersionsDeleteOptionalParams) => Promise<void>
deleteAtManagementGroup
Questa operazione elimina la versione della definizione del set di policy nel gruppo di gestione dato con il nome e la versione di battesimo.
deleteAtManagementGroup: (managementGroupName: string, policySetDefinitionName: string, policyDefinitionVersion: string, options?: PolicySetDefinitionVersionsDeleteAtManagementGroupOptionalParams) => Promise<void>
Valore della proprietà
(managementGroupName: string, policySetDefinitionName: string, policyDefinitionVersion: string, options?: PolicySetDefinitionVersionsDeleteAtManagementGroupOptionalParams) => Promise<void>
get
Questa operazione recupera la versione della definizione del set di policy nell'abbonamento fornito con il nome e la versione.
get: (policySetDefinitionName: string, policyDefinitionVersion: string, options?: PolicySetDefinitionVersionsGetOptionalParams) => Promise<PolicySetDefinitionVersion>
Valore della proprietà
(policySetDefinitionName: string, policyDefinitionVersion: string, options?: PolicySetDefinitionVersionsGetOptionalParams) => Promise<PolicySetDefinitionVersion>
getAtManagementGroup
Questa operazione recupera la versione della definizione del set di policy nel gruppo di gestione dato con il nome e la versione propria.
getAtManagementGroup: (managementGroupName: string, policySetDefinitionName: string, policyDefinitionVersion: string, options?: PolicySetDefinitionVersionsGetAtManagementGroupOptionalParams) => Promise<PolicySetDefinitionVersion>
Valore della proprietà
(managementGroupName: string, policySetDefinitionName: string, policyDefinitionVersion: string, options?: PolicySetDefinitionVersionsGetAtManagementGroupOptionalParams) => Promise<PolicySetDefinitionVersion>
getBuiltIn
Questa operazione recupera la versione integrata della definizione del set di policy con il nome e la versione.
getBuiltIn: (policySetDefinitionName: string, policyDefinitionVersion: string, options?: PolicySetDefinitionVersionsGetBuiltInOptionalParams) => Promise<PolicySetDefinitionVersion>
Valore della proprietà
(policySetDefinitionName: string, policyDefinitionVersion: string, options?: PolicySetDefinitionVersionsGetBuiltInOptionalParams) => Promise<PolicySetDefinitionVersion>
list
Questa operazione recupera una lista di tutte le versioni di definizione del set di policy per la definizione del set di policy data.
list: (policySetDefinitionName: string, options?: PolicySetDefinitionVersionsListOptionalParams) => PagedAsyncIterableIterator<PolicySetDefinitionVersion, PolicySetDefinitionVersion[], PageSettings>
Valore della proprietà
(policySetDefinitionName: string, options?: PolicySetDefinitionVersionsListOptionalParams) => PagedAsyncIterableIterator<PolicySetDefinitionVersion, PolicySetDefinitionVersion[], PageSettings>
listAll
Questa operazione elenca tutte le versioni di definizione di set di policy per tutte le definizioni di set di policy all'interno di un abbonamento.
listAll: (options?: PolicySetDefinitionVersionsListAllOptionalParams) => Promise<_PolicySetDefinitionVersionListResult>
Valore della proprietà
(options?: PolicySetDefinitionVersionsListAllOptionalParams) => Promise<_PolicySetDefinitionVersionListResult>
listAllAtManagementGroup
Questa operazione elenca tutte le versioni di definizione dei set di policy per tutte le definizioni di set di policy nell'ambito del gruppo di gestione.
listAllAtManagementGroup: (managementGroupName: string, options?: PolicySetDefinitionVersionsListAllAtManagementGroupOptionalParams) => Promise<_PolicySetDefinitionVersionListResult>
Valore della proprietà
(managementGroupName: string, options?: PolicySetDefinitionVersionsListAllAtManagementGroupOptionalParams) => Promise<_PolicySetDefinitionVersionListResult>
listAllBuiltins
Questa operazione elenca tutte le versioni integrate delle definizioni di set di policy per tutte le definizioni di set di policy integrate.
listAllBuiltins: (options?: PolicySetDefinitionVersionsListAllBuiltinsOptionalParams) => Promise<_PolicySetDefinitionVersionListResult>
Valore della proprietà
(options?: PolicySetDefinitionVersionsListAllBuiltinsOptionalParams) => Promise<_PolicySetDefinitionVersionListResult>
listBuiltIn
Questa operazione recupera un elenco di tutte le versioni di definizione del set di policy integrate per la definizione del set di policy integrata data.
listBuiltIn: (policySetDefinitionName: string, options?: PolicySetDefinitionVersionsListBuiltInOptionalParams) => PagedAsyncIterableIterator<PolicySetDefinitionVersion, PolicySetDefinitionVersion[], PageSettings>
Valore della proprietà
(policySetDefinitionName: string, options?: PolicySetDefinitionVersionsListBuiltInOptionalParams) => PagedAsyncIterableIterator<PolicySetDefinitionVersion, PolicySetDefinitionVersion[], PageSettings>
listByManagementGroup
Questa operazione recupera un elenco di tutte le versioni di definizione del set di policy per la definizione del set di policy data in un dato gruppo di gestione.
listByManagementGroup: (managementGroupName: string, policySetDefinitionName: string, options?: PolicySetDefinitionVersionsListByManagementGroupOptionalParams) => PagedAsyncIterableIterator<PolicySetDefinitionVersion, PolicySetDefinitionVersion[], PageSettings>
Valore della proprietà
(managementGroupName: string, policySetDefinitionName: string, options?: PolicySetDefinitionVersionsListByManagementGroupOptionalParams) => PagedAsyncIterableIterator<PolicySetDefinitionVersion, PolicySetDefinitionVersion[], PageSettings>